Transaction ef92c81a921104bcbbe40188f97e1fe992bd63dbc1a51ed3270b41e2994488ba
1 Input
1 Output
-
ef92c81a921104bcbbe40188f97e1fe992bd63dbc1a51ed3270b41e2994488ba:0
- value
- 27657814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57d2c097cb7412f4d65a6e1617ecb258da5f9048 OP_EQUAL
- address
- 39hPBZUGDMpbs4vyuiDLVoCZJpt8CSUyoT